SACUBO to Celebrate 100 Years
Start making plans to join SACUBO for a yearlong celebration to begin at the 2027 Annual Convention with a focus on celebrating and honoring SACUBO’s history and concluding at the 2028 Annual Convention with the focus to bring SACUBO into the next 100 years.
Volunteer Spotlight: Melyatta Powers, MBA
From skepticism to "game-changer" insights, Melyatta Powers’ journey with SACUBO is a masterclass in the power of saying "yes" to opportunity. With 25 years of expertise in higher education, Melyatta currently serves on the Research Constituents Committee, where she turns leadership theory into tangible practice.
Whether she is transforming her professional perspective through deep dives into AI or crafting handcrafted pottery for her "favorite patron" (her daughter), Melyatta embodies the spirit of continuous growth. Her story is a testament to how SACUBO isn't just a professional network—it’s a direct investment in your career and a space to navigate the complexities of our industry alongside the best in the field.
